New submission from Mark Dickinson <dicki...@gmail.com>: test_telnetlib fails consistently on OS X 10.6, for a default (64-bit) build of py3k. Test output below.
It looks to me as though this is just a race condition in the test (possibly combined with socket-related peculiarities of OS X) rather than a problem with telnetlib itself. I suspect that the 'server' function in test_telnetlib.py is getting to the 'serv.close()' line prematurely, before all the test data from the 'test_write' test have been written.
